Product Designer - Furniture
Job Title: Product Designer
Job Description

We are seeking a skilled Product Designer to design engineered solutions for the manufacturing of residential and vehicle seating products. The role involves driving improvements in quality performance and cost while leading development teams to meet project goals and complete them on time. The Product Designer will specify materials and manufacturing processes for new or existing designs, validate designs using engineering calculations or analysis software, and conduct product testing to ensure compliance with quality standards.

ResponsibilitiesDesign engineered solutions used in the manufacturing of seating products.Participate in and lead development teams to meet project goals and cost targets.Specify materials and manufacturing processes for new or existing designs.Validate designs using engineering calculations or analysis software.Conduct or coordinate product testing for compliance with quality standards.Assist in prototyping and trialing new product designs or improvements.Create drawings and documentation for use by various departments.Process Engineering Change Requests (ECRs) in a timely manner.Stay informed with Intellectual Property (IP) in the furniture industry.Enter and maintain product data in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) systems.Up to 10% domestic/international travel may be required.Essential SkillsProficiency in SolidWorks and AutoCAD.Mechanical engineering expertise.Experience in mechanical design and new product development.Ability to validate designs using engineering calculations or software.Additional Skills & QualificationsExperience in new product introduction projects from concept to launch.Knowledge of specifying materials and manufacturing processes.Strong collaboration skills to work with various departments.Understanding of Intellectual Property in the furniture industry.Work Environment

The work environment involves collaborating with multiple departments such as PD&E, Manufacturing, Quality, Marketing, and Merchandising. The position may require domestic and international travel up to 10%.
